想自己构建档案管理系统?首先要明确需求,包括确定档案类型、了解使用用户、分析功能需求。接着规划系统架构,涵盖硬件与软件架构。然后选择合适的开发工具和技术,如编程语言、开发框架和库。再进行数据库设计,包括实体关系建模和表结构设计。最后开展系统开发,分前端界面开发和后端功能开发两大块。按照这些步骤,就能构建出贴合自身需求的档案管理系统。
我在一个小公司上班,现在公司资料越来越多了,想自己搞个档案管理系统方便整理,但我又没经验,不知道咋弄呢?
自己构建档案管理系统可以按照以下步骤:
一、需求分析
1. 确定要管理的档案类型,例如是文档、图片还是其他类型。
2. 考虑档案的规模大小,是少量文件还是海量数据。
3. 明确不同用户对档案的访问权限,如普通员工只能查看,管理员可编辑等。
二、选择技术框架(如果有一定技术能力)
1. 如果熟悉数据库,可以选择MySQL之类的关系型数据库来存储档案元数据(如档案名称、创建时间等信息)。
2. 对于档案存储,可以是本地服务器存储或者云存储(像阿里云OSS等)。
3. 在开发工具方面,若会编程,Java结合Spring框架或者Python的Django框架都可用于构建系统的后端逻辑。
三、功能设计
1. 档案上传功能,要确保能批量上传并且检查文件格式是否符合要求。
2. 档案分类功能,可按照日期、部门、项目等分类。
3. 搜索功能,让用户能快速定位到想要的档案。
4. 版本控制功能(如果档案有更新需求),记录不同版本的档案。
四、界面设计
1. 保持简洁易用的原则,布局清晰。
2. 提供操作引导提示。
五、测试与优化
1. 内部小规模试用,收集反馈,比如是否存在操作不便的地方。
2. 根据反馈调整功能或界面布局。
不过自己构建档案管理系统需要花费较多的时间和精力,而且可能存在一些技术风险。如果您希望更轻松高效地拥有一个专业的档案管理系统,欢迎点击免费注册试用我们公司的档案管理解决方案。

我打算自己做个档案管理系统,可是一头雾水,完全不知道重点在哪,就像盖房子不知道从哪开始打地基一样。
自己做档案管理系统有以下要点:
1. 安全性
- 要确保档案数据不被泄露或非法访问。这包括设置严格的用户登录验证机制,如密码强度要求、多因素认证等。
- 对档案的传输过程加密,如果是网络存储,要防止数据在传输途中被截取。
2. 可靠性
- 保证系统稳定运行,避免频繁出现故障导致档案无法访问。例如采用可靠的硬件设备(如果是自建服务器)或者选择稳定的云服务提供商。
- 建立数据备份策略,定期备份档案数据,以防数据丢失。
3. 易用性
- 设计直观的操作界面,让不同计算机水平的用户都能轻松上手。例如操作流程尽量简化,菜单选项清晰明了。
- 提供良好的用户帮助文档或提示信息,当用户遇到问题时能够快速找到解决方法。
4. 兼容性
- 要兼容不同的操作系统,如Windows、Mac等,这样不同用户的设备都能正常使用系统。
- 对各种常见的档案格式兼容,确保不同类型的档案都能被管理。
自己做档案管理系统虽然有一定的自主性,但也面临诸多挑战。我们公司提供成熟的档案管理系统,欢迎预约演示,看看专业系统是如何满足这些要点的。
我就是个普通上班族,对那些编程啥的一窍不通,但是公司现在需要一个档案管理系统,我想自己建一个,感觉无从下手啊。
如果没有技术基础要自己建档案管理系统,可以尝试以下途径:
一、利用低代码/无代码平台
1. 市面上有很多低代码/无代码平台,例如简某云等。这些平台提供可视化的操作界面。
2. 你可以在平台上通过简单的拖拽、设置参数等操作来构建档案管理系统的基本框架。比如定义档案的表单结构,就像填写表格一样简单。
3. 根据需求添加功能模块,如查询、筛选档案的功能,无需编写代码就能实现。
二、借助模板
1. 有些办公软件(如Microsoft SharePoint)提供档案管理系统的模板。
2. 你可以下载这些模板并根据自己的实际情况进行修改。主要修改内容包括档案分类的设定、用户权限的配置等。
三、外包部分工作(如果预算允许)
1. 可以找自由开发者或者小型开发团队,把核心的技术部分外包给他们,如数据库搭建等。
2. 自己则负责需求沟通、系统测试等环节。
虽然这些方法可以在没有技术基础的情况下构建档案管理系统,但可能会存在一些局限性。如果想要更完善、功能更强大的档案管理系统,欢迎点击免费注册试用我们的产品。
免责申明:本文内容通过 AI 工具匹配关键字智能整合而成,仅供参考,伙伴云不对内容的真实、准确、完整作任何形式的承诺。如有任何问题或意见,您可以通过联系 12345@huoban.com 进行反馈,伙伴云收到您的反馈后将及时处理并反馈。



































